为什么我的本地结帐在 Spartacus 1.5 上失败?

Why does my local checkout fails on Spartacus 1.5?

错误

*polyfills.js:3050 GET https://localhost:9002/rest/v2/powertools/cms/pages?fields=DEFAULT&pageType=ContentPage&pageLabelOrId=/checkout&lang=en&curr=USD 404*

我无法在本地的 powertools 和 electronics 站点上执行结帐。 Chrome 控制台日志抱怨上面显示的错误。另外,我尝试在新选项卡中打开给定的 link,它显示 No content page found matching the provided label or id: /checkout。检查了我本地后台的 WCMS 页面,我找不到任何标签或 ID 为“checkout”的页面。

难道我必须用 b2c_for_spartacus 设置本地? (我已经用 b2c_b2b_acc_oms 食谱设置了我的)

您是否使用 Spartacus 示例数据插件安装了 SAP Commerce 实例?标准的 Powertools 数据设置不包括这个,但 spartacussampleadataaddon 中的添加包括。请参阅 https://sap.github.io/cloud-commerce-spartacus-storefront-docs/installing-sap-commerce-cloud/

中的 links/instructions

如果 installed/setup 正确,您应该在 powertools-spaContentCatalog 内容目录中有一个 UID=Checkout 的内容页面